By: Monica Crawford

Three years ago, I sat on the couch as my husband (then fiance) kissed me goodbye before going into work. It was the day after I resigned from my former police department and the first time in over a year that we wouldn't be getting in the same car to drive into work together.

In fact, we wouldn't be working the same job or same shift with each other ever again. A sobering thought at the time considering law enforcement was how we met and something we enjoyed being able to do together.

After he left for work, I wrote a post titled, Saving the Brotherhood, and shared it to Facebook. My thoughts at the time were so pure, even in my current state of hurt. I had no idea what I would be facing in my own healing journey in the coming months or even inside of my business and my career after that moment.

This caught the eye of Joel E. Gordon, of BLUE Magazine, and thus became my very first published work as an article for BLUE Magazine. With support and enthusiasm, BLUE Magazine has chosen to publish many more pieces of my work over the last three years in The Blue Magazine.

I never imagined I would be a writer let alone a published author. It's easy to see the connection of one leading to the other when writing my book, "Thriving Inside the Thin Blue Line." At the time, I never would have believed it.

Closing the door to an employer who blocked my opportunities, and did not value, support or respect me, gave me the push to leave, which is the very thing I needed to do.

A few months before I resigned from the police department, I saw an ad on Facebook for a business coach. Realizing I had enough education and experience in the nutrition and fitness space from years of being a NCAA Division I gymnast, CrossFit Trainer and Nutrition Coach, I knew I had the ability to help other women in male-driven fields through my same experiences and coach them to achieving things they never dreamed they could.

I created Five-0 Fierce and Fit and never looked back.

Closing that first door opened the first of many doors into entrepreneurship, traveling across the U.S. to network, present keynote speeches and teach, create a podcast, and write a book about my experiences, in hopes of highlighting what needs changed, and validating many others who have experienced the same and who also want positive change inside law enforcement.
